Our Deluxe Ocean & Waterfall Adventure is the most popular of all three of our adventures! Join us for three hours of pure fun, fantastic scenery, and magical surroundings. From the mountains to the sea on an ATV, this is the most real experience Hawaii has to offer!

There are some people who want it all, and if that’s your idea of happiness, then join us for an exploration of the diverse beauty and soul of Kohala. This is the only tour in Hawaii that you can stand at a serene ocean bay and minutes later be immersed in a tropical rainforest waterfall. A beyond awesome adventure!

As you ride along our striking Kohala coastline alongside 200 foot majestic ocean cliffs, you will feel your spirits soar. This is one time you will want your camera. The views are magnificent. Your journey continues as we arrive at a private and secluded bay with a bird’s eye view of Keawaeli Bay – a once famed King Kamehameha’s playground for the warmest winter surf of 20 to 30 feet..

This bay was once the playground and property of royalty. Its rich heritage is revealed to you as you experience its beauty. The quest for the heart of Kohala deepens as you continue your ride from 250 feet above sea level traveling to the 2500 foot elevation, where you enter the rarified air of the oldest rainforest on the Big Island. Passing through a cool eucalyptus rainforest, past brisk mountain streams, we ride under canopies of trees and lanes of wild ginger. Some of the exotic plants found in our rainforest are not found anywhere else in world.

We visit a picture-perfect tropical waterfall, and short hike to the foot of the refreshing pond below. It’s all completely private and exclusive. And if you want to leave Kohala knowing you have truly seen into its soul – then this land, this journey is for you.

Requirements:

  • Names, heights and weights, and age (if under 18 years old) REQUIRED of all participants no later than 24 hours prior to the tour
  • Children ages 5-15 years old are able to participate as a passenger. Restrictions apply.
  • A parent or legal guardian (with letter) must accompany anyone under the age of 18 years old.
  • Single Rider ATV: Drivers must be at least 16 years of age and weigh 100-300 lbs and a minimum of 5 ft tall.
  • *Drivers under the age of 18 are REQUIRED to present identification showing proof of age at the time of check-in.
    If unable to provide ID at that time, they will not be able to drive their own ATV and there will be no adjustment to charges.
  • Drivers with passengers must be at least 25 years of age.
  • Two Passenger Tandem ATV: Driver must be at least 25 years of age. Passenger must be at least 12 years old, 5’ tall, and have a minimum weight of 85 lbs. Passengers weight cannot exceed the weight of the driver. Maximum combined weight is 350 lbs.
  • Two Passenger Side by Side ATV: Driver must be at least 25 years of age and 5’4”. Maximum combined weight is 500 lbs. Passenger must be at least 5 years old and have a minimum weight of 45 lbs.
  • Four Passenger ATV: Driver must be at least 25 years of age and 5’4”. Maximum combined weight is 650 lbs. Passengers must be at least 5 years old and have a minimum weight of 45 lbs.
  • All riders must wear shirt, long pants and completely covered shoes.
  • Go Pros or similar devices may be used during stops only, no exceptions!
  • Helmets, goggles and gloves are provided (mandatory).

*We are unable to accommodate expectant mothers, people who have had recent surgery or have chronic back and or neck problems.
